メインコンテンツにスキップ

empty_constructor_bodies

空のコンストラクタ本体は、'{}' ではなく ';' を使用して記述すべきです。

説明

#

コンストラクタが空のブロック本体を持つ場合、アナライザはこの診断を生成します。

#

次のコードは、C のコンストラクタが空のブロック本体を持っているため、この診断を生成します。

dart
class C {
  C() {}
}

一般的な修正

#

ブロックをセミコロンに置き換える

dart
class C {
  C();
}